How do i find out if someone truely has a contractor's license in california?

i had taken someone's word for it, but i want to double check without them knowing. what is a website or phone number i can check with based only on their name?

Answers:
http://www.cslb.ca.gov/

Contractor's License Board.

Under the sidebar for Consumers, there is a PDF file for instructions for searching for the Contractor by their business name, personnel name, or license number.

The easiest way, if the contractor is legit, is to ask them for their license number. If they can't provide it to you, then they are working illegally.
